It looks just like the one in my Ponton ; I expect it probably is the same , as will be the cap , and will also be shared with the 300 Adenauer models . I would be most surprised if these are not available new from the dealerships .

Niesoller list them ( for the original distributor ) . My car is a W105 and has the M180 , also 6 cylinder but 2195cc , the cap and rotor look very similar to what is in your photos .


Also this may be of help


As an option , the 123 electronic distributor , made in the netherlands , should be suitable , and would give you contactless ignition , while still looking original under the bonnet - if you contact them they are very helpful .


In fact they state this one is suitable for the 300SL
